Job Description
The County Government of Kakamega is looking to recruit Assistant Engineer II (Water & Sewerage) officers. This is an entry and training grade for this cadre, where officers will work under the guidance and supervision of a senior officer to support the county's water and sewerage infrastructure development.
Duties and Responsibilities
Carrying out feasibility studies for water and sewerage projects.
Planning and designing water supply and sewerage infrastructures.
Carrying out research activities in various aspects of water, sewerage, and hydraulic systems.
Requirements for Appointment
For appointment to this grade, a candidate must have:
A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ering from a recognized institution.
Registration by the Engineers Registration Board of Kenya (ERB) as a Graduate Engineer.
A Certificate in Computer Applications from a recognized institution.
Salary and Terms of Service
Basic Salary: Kshs. 39,700 x 1,470 – 41,170 x 1,520 – 42,690 x 1,710 – 44,400 x 1920 – 46,320 x 2,000 – 48,320 x 2,290 – 50,610 x 2,350 – 52,960 p.m.
Terms of Service: Permanent and Pensionable.
